i think its really a matter of what name you wanna be on:YFZ350 or YFZ450,in dirtywheels they said that the 450 will easily accelerate with the shee until top end and the shee pulls away slighty,but if u put em on a hill stock 4 stock the 450 will eat it alive.they also said somethin about how advanced the steering system was over the shee too,i would go with the 450 thumper becuz i dont like TOO much maintenance and having to worry about the premixing

Stock for Stock, the 450 is just plain built better. (ie suspension.) You can mod pretty much anything to make them equal out... but in the end, the 450 has a lower center of gravity, and the most power to weight ratio of any 4 stroke out there. I haven't ridden the newest shee... but i'd still go w/ the 450...
